Spektrumlogik
Dette bånd bliver meningsfuldt kun, når det læses sammen med sine nabotoppe. I praksis ser analytikere først på tildelingerne ovenfor, og kontrollerer derefter, om den samme prøve også viser andre toppe, der forventes for det samme strukturelle motiv. Et enkelt bånd nær 3276 cm⁻¹ er normalt ikke nok til materialeidentifikation alene.

Almindelige fejl
- Behandling af et isoleret bånd som bevis på et materiale uden at kontrollere mindst en eller to understøttende toppe.
- Ignorerer overlap: flere funktionelle grupper kan bidrage nær samme bølgetal.
- Spring validering over, når additiver, blandinger, oxidation eller forurening kan forvrænge spektret.
Verifikationsrådgivning
Når tvetydighed fortsat består, valider hypotesen med DSC, GC-MS eller TGA, især for blandinger, nedbrudte prøver og fyldte polymerer.
